Abstract
The purpose of this study is to determine the impact of taxation, tunneling incentives, bonus mechanisms, and profitability on the transfer pricing of man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X). The study period used was 5 years, 2017-2021. The subject of this study includes all man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) between 2017 and 2021. The sampling technique is a targeted sampling technique. Based on certain criteria, 34 companies were identified. The type of data used is secondary data obtained from the Indonesia Stock Exchange website. The analysis method adopted is panel data regression analysis. The results show that bonuses and profit mechanisms have an impact on transfer pricing. At the same time, tax and tunnel construction incentives have no impact on transfer pricing.
